At Slingshotjr's point, though - Dev said on twitter that his mind was effectively blown when Dirk Verbeuren recorded his parts for the title track (then Cheeseburger) because he'd actually written the song with the intent of making it impossible to be performed by a human. Thus, why I'm positive that it's not a drum machine you're hearing during Thordendal's solo, but an (in)human performance instead.
